Add virtual void Fl_Graphics_Driver::set_status() and implement for X11 platform.

This commit is contained in:
ManoloFLTK
2022-01-07 07:50:23 +01:00
parent 9d474dfcdf
commit 27c175dad8
7 changed files with 11 additions and 8 deletions
+2
View File
@@ -356,8 +356,10 @@ public:
virtual float scale_font_for_PostScript(Fl_Font_Descriptor *desc, int s);
// default implementation may be enough
virtual float scale_bitmap_for_PostScript();
// next 3 are related to X Input Method
virtual void set_spot(int font, int size, int X, int Y, int W, int H, Fl_Window *win);
virtual void reset_spot();
virtual void set_status(int X, int Y, int W, int H);
// each platform implements these 3 functions its own way
virtual void add_rectangle_to_region(Fl_Region r, int x, int y, int w, int h);
virtual Fl_Region XRectangleRegion(int x, int y, int w, int h);